For starters, there is no fixed price for a unit of goods in context advertising (existing, indeed, exceptions, like a T-Rorer network, but they are rare). The reason is that the value of sales in the context of bonds is determined by an auction between advertisers, so the price of the click at each time may vary. Despite the fact that the sites often claim that they can buy evidence from a “one rouble”, it does not mean that they are willing to throw a commercial in cheap traffic. In Yandex and Google, for example, there is a notion of " minimum rate " that might be much higher. Fortunately, this minimum rate is only searchable, and there is still room for rubles from the Network. It's only gonna be a little bit of them, because competition won't drill, and the low rate on your keywords means that the probability of advertising will be reduced to a minimum value.
